Overview

The internet is a complex yet fascinating system that connects users from all corners of the globe. When someone in England visits a website hosted in the United States, an intricate series of processes takes place, almost instantaneously transporting information across vast distances. Understanding how this all works not only enhances our appreciation of technology but also demystifies the entire browsing experience we often take for granted.

The process of data transfer involves numerous networks and hubs, with packets of information journeying through a seemingly endless web of connections. From copper wires and fiber optic cables to regional servers, the flow of data is highly organized and efficient. This behind-the-scenes operation showcases the remarkable engineering that enables us to access and interact with web pages in real-time.

Features

  • Dynamic Data Transfer: Upon making a request, your computer converts it into a virtual packet that contains all necessary information to retrieve the desired webpage.

  • Global Infrastructure: Data packets travel through a vast network of underground copper wires and fiber optic cables, crossing oceans to reach their destination efficiently.

  • Main Hubs: Key locations like Telehouse North in London and 60 Hudson Street in NYC serve as critical internet hubs, managing and redirecting data seamlessly.

  • Packetization: Webpages are split into thousands of data packets, ensuring that even large amounts of information can be transmitted quickly and effectively.

  • Front-End vs Back-End: The user experience is divided into front-end elements that we interact with and back-end processes that manage server-side logic and data retrieval.

  • Static vs Dynamic Pages: Understanding the difference between static and dynamic pages enhances your knowledge of how websites respond to user interactions, as dynamic pages adapt based on server-side code.

  • Real-Time Communication: The journey of data packets happens within seconds, allowing for rapid access to online content, underscoring the speed and efficiency of internet communication.

  • Advanced Technologies: Through the use of technologies like HTML, CSS, and JavaScript, websites can provide complex user interactions and visually appealing interfaces.
